Application
Used as an intermediate and an antioxidant in aviation gasoline; Used as an intermediate for the production of higher molecular weight phenolic antioxidants; Also used as an oxidation inhibitor and stabilizer for fuel, oil, and gasoline.

Stability
Stable. Incompatible with acid chlorides, acid anhydrides, bases, brass, copper, copper alloys, oxidizing agents.
